Your wash day routine and product components can affect the texture and feel of your hair, no matter your hair type. Hence, you have to be mindful. Adding a Pre-shampoo to your wash day routine might be all you need to make it less stressful. First things first ....


What Is a Pre-Shampoo/ Pre-poo? A Pre-poo, as the name implies, is a step you take to prep your hair before using a shampoo. Adding this extra step offers so many benefits such as:


It adds moisture to your hair: Shampoos can strip your hair of oils and moisture, which will leave your hair and scalp dry. A pre-poo prevents that by moisturizing your hair beforehand.

It makes detangling easier: A pre-poo helps prevent hair loss by making your hair easier to detangle. By making your hair slippery, your curls become loose and quick to comb through.

It makes hair softer: An important benefit of adding a pre-poo to your wash day routine is that it keeps your hair soft and protected. With softer hair, you can easily manage it and your wash day will be less of a hassle.
